La diffusion est un processus dans lequel un type d'objet est explicitement converti en un autre type si la conversion est autorisée. Ce processus peut conduire à un changement de valeur.
J'ai le code simple suivant: int speed1 = (int)(6.2f * 10); float tmp = 6.2f * 10; int speed2 = (int)tmp; speed1et speed2devrait avoir la même valeur, mais en fait, j'ai: speed1 = 61 speed2 = 62 Je sais que je devrais probablement utiliser Math.Round au lieu de cast, mais …
Dans PostgreSQL, j'ai une table avec une colonne varchar. Les données sont censées être des nombres entiers et j'en ai besoin en type entier dans une requête. Certaines valeurs sont des chaînes vides. Le suivant: SELECT myfield::integer FROM mytable rendements ERROR: invalid input syntax for integer: "" Comment puis-je interroger …
Je préfère généralement coder R pour ne pas recevoir d'avertissements, mais je ne sais pas comment éviter de recevoir un avertissement lors de l'utilisation as.numericpour convertir un vecteur de caractères. Par exemple: x <- as.numeric(c("1", "2", "X")) Me donnera un avertissement car il a introduit les NA par la coercition. …
J'importe des données à partir d'une table qui a des flux bruts dans Varchar, j'ai besoin d'importer une colonne dans varchar dans une colonne de chaîne. J'ai essayé d'utiliser <column_name>::integeraussi bien que to_number(<column_name>,'9999999')mais j'obtiens des erreurs, car il y a quelques champs vides, je dois les récupérer comme vides ou …
Il est peu probable que cette question aide les futurs visiteurs; il n'est pertinent que pour une petite zone géographique, un moment précis dans le temps ou une situation extraordinairement étroite qui n'est généralement pas applicable à l'audience mondiale d'Internet. Pour obtenir de l'aide pour rendre cette question plus large, …
Je ne connais pas du tout PHP et j'avais une petite question. J'ai 2 variables pricePerUnitet InvoicedUnits. Voici le code qui définit ces valeurs: $InvoicedUnits = ((string) $InvoiceLineItem->InvoicedUnits); $pricePerUnit = ((string) $InvoiceLineItem->PricePerUnit); Si je produis ceci, j'obtiens les valeurs correctes. Disons les 5000unités facturées et 1.00pour le prix. Maintenant, je …
J'ai ci - dessous requête et nécessité de casting idàvarchar Schéma create table t9 (id int, name varchar (55)); insert into t9( id, name)values(2, 'bob'); Ce que j'ai essayé select CAST(id as VARCHAR(50)) as col1 from t9; select CONVERT(VARCHAR(50),id) as colI1 from t9; mais ils ne fonctionnent pas. Veuillez suggérer.
En Java, je veux convertir un double en entier, je sais si vous faites ceci: double x = 1.5; int y = (int)x; vous obtenez y = 1. Si tu fais ça: int y = (int)Math.round(x); Vous en obtiendrez probablement 2. Cependant, je me demande: puisque les doubles représentations d'entiers …
public interface IDic { int Id { get; set; } string Name { get; set; } } public class Client : IDic { } Comment puis - je jeter List<Client>à List<IDic>?
Avant de mettre à jour xCode 6, je n'avais aucun problème à convertir un double en chaîne mais maintenant cela me donne une erreur var a: Double = 1.5 var b: String = String(a) Cela me donne le message d'erreur "le double n'est pas convertible en chaîne". Y a-t-il un …
J'ai besoin d'obtenir la valeur d'un champ en utilisant la réflexion. Il se trouve que je ne suis pas toujours sûr du type de données du champ. Pour cela, et pour éviter une duplication de code, j'ai créé la méthode suivante: @SuppressWarnings("unchecked") private static <T> T getValueByReflection(VarInfo var, Class<?> classUnderTest, …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.